Output e2c68399736e84993684a756f315322be7572d63302a410902142141714f2a7f:7

value
48234716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d391a5d8d73118d97b055a654bedb5e84e7508 OP_EQUAL
address
MFpFnzfbPzjDqWrq8ieHbDNfzj79mLriJ4
transaction
e2c68399736e84993684a756f315322be7572d63302a410902142141714f2a7f
spent
true